Hollywood and global streaming networks heavily rely on comic entertainment. Beyond the multi-billion-dollar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U), platforms like Netflix, Amazon Prime, and Apple TV+ aggressively adapt indie comic books and manga into live-action series. Successes like The Boys (based on the Dynamite Entertainment comic) and the live-action adaptation of Eiichiro Oda’s One Piece prove that comic-based media content crosses cultural boundaries when executed with respect for the source material. 3.
